Maar Gan. take the road south of the village towards the east until you get in a foyada (valley). Follow the valley north until you find a path to the east. Take it. After the road bends to the north, you will encounter a fork: go east and you will find Lost Kogoruhn (Dunmer stronghold). Don't enter it unless you want to meet some 6th house fellows. Get to the north eastern corner and you will see a road going east: take it until you find a dunmer outlaw camp slightly to the south. Kora Dur is east-south-east of that camp, just behind the mountain range. You will have to turn around the cliffs (by going north) or levitate.
